Abstract

This project addresses aspects in spatial transcriptomics analysis using Seq-Scope data. The presence of transcript coordinates erroneously mapped outside of biological tissue, arising from image alignment inaccuracies and sequencing noise, can significantly distort downstream analyses, including spatial clustering and gene expression interpretation. To improve data quality, filtering pipelines were developed to remove transcript events that fall outside a refined tissue segmentation mask derived from microscopy images. The pipeline incorporates mask preprocessing techniques to eliminate ambiguous boundary regions and accurately define tissue contours, followed by coordinate transformation to align transcript data with the image space.
